Staff must record each day what things are related to safe supervision?
a) when children arrive
b) when children leave
c) whom they leave with
Children arrive and depart according to the written instructions from their families; for example….
1) children under 6 arrive and depart with adult supervision
2) children under 6-8 may walk to and from school alone or with friends with the written permission of their parents
3) children over 8 may come or leave alone with the written permission of parents

At least ___ staff must be present with each group of children at all times, are in nearby rooms or areas, or the area is monitored by closed circuit TV
2
Staff to child ratio should be
1) 1 to 10 for ages of 6 or older
2) 1 to 8 for ages five and older
(If your ratio exceeds 1 to 10, contact your PC)
Volunteer and summer hired should NOT be counted in meeting____.
Staff to child ratios
